The Basement saves lives - working with people in chaos to provide a safety net, through to those who want to change and recover. Our service is unique and fills the gaps in the treatment for substance and alcohol abuse.
We feed about 70 people twice weekly and have supported dozens this year through our addiction recovery programme. People wishing to stop drinking /drugging and regain control to their lives really can and do through our service.

RecoveryTimes is our quarterly newsletter written by those people who have directly benefited from The Basement Recovery Programme and who have achieved abstinence over their drug or alcohol addiction. The newsletter is distributed in hardcopy to 1000 people and local organisations (currently limited by funding), and to 1000's more electronically. The Basement provides twice weekly drop-ins for food and showers and laundry. We also offer advice from housing workers, routes into treatment from substance misuse and a befriending service. read more
